How they compare
Bosnia and Herzegovina currently reports 7.0% against 6.6% in Latvia, a difference of 0.4%.
That makes Bosnia and Herzegovina's figure about 1.1 times Latvia's.
Across all 5 years both countries report, Bosnia and Herzegovina has been ahead every year.
Bosnia and Herzegovina ranks 19th and Latvia ranks 22nd of 43 countries.
